All inverters providing ready-to-use 120VAC have an idle consumption. There is a cost to running the circuitry that generates the 120VAC and 60Hz frequency. My 4kW Victron is about 30W
They do consume some idle power, usually 5-10W. But otherwise the input power scales with the output power (with some additional input power due to efficiency losses of 10-20%).
